The best island in the Caribbean for Honeymoon???

My fiancee and I are trying to plan our honeymoon. There are so many beautiful locations to choose from that we just can't decide and need some advice. We are looking for a location that has white sand beaches, romantic settings, luxury accomodations without the luxury price, sightseeing, water activities, and not a big crowd. We will be traveling the first week in May and would like to keep the trip under $5000. Some places we have thought about: Jamaica, St. Johns, Cancun, and St.Lucis. Please help if you have any good advice!

Have you considered Negril, Jamaica, a very romantic beautiful part of the island? About an hour from Montego Bay Airport (away from the congestion), try an all inclusive like the Couples resort in Negril, or Couples Swept Away. I think those places you can get for under $5000.00, I think we paid about $3500.00 for a 5 night stay, at the Couples Resort (very romantic, and COUPLES only, which makes it that much more romantic!)

St. John has the most beautiful beaches. You can stay @ The Westin or Caneel Bay (which has no phones or no swimming pools). The Westin has a beautiful swimming pool. You must rent a car to go to beautiful beaches in St. John.

Also, another very upscale resort is the Ritz Carlton in St. Thomas. Very pretty.

Another suggestion that you haven't mentioned is Bermuda. It is a beautifully charming island filled with wonderful beaches and hidden coves where you and you future husband can go by yourself. You can't rent a car there, but you rent scooters instead. Such fun. I recommend the Reefs or Southampton Princess.

Melissa, Couples resorts in Jamaica would be a great spot, particuarly Couples Negril.

I wouldn't recommend Cancun for a honeymoon. It has become so Americanized and there is too much going on. If wanting to go to Mexico, Cozumel would be better which isn't far from Cancun. You may want to check into the Royal Hideaway resort, although it is not couples only.

If looking for white sand beaches, you won't find them in St. Lucia. This is an island with dark sand but the island is very lush and tropical, great if you're looking to explore outside the resort.

I have never visited St. John but have heard nothing but great things about it. I had a co-worker who honeymooned at the Westin last year and she had a wonderful time. Good luck and congrats!

There are advantages to all-inclusive but it is not for everyone. We do like to travel on the AI plan because we love the fact of not having to worry about paying as we go or a checkout bill, not tipping (although we still do at times), and jsut knowing that literally everything is included. We too are not big drinkers at all but just the food alone could cost a fortune not to mention the water sports that you might not pay for if it was not included since those too are very expensive.

For granted, however, you do miss a certain degree of the island flare in terms of the local foods. But we still will go off for lunch when out and about or a dinner to savor local dishes in true island surrondings.

I also do vote for NEgril, Jamaica. We have been to Jamaica a number of times and Negril is really the better part of the island, in addition to Prt Antonio.

In Negril, we stayed at the Grand Lido. Itis a first rate resort with beautiful accomondations, food and service and it should still fall well below the price range you are looking at.

We have not been to Cpuples but have heard good things about it too. A site called www.tropictravelonline.com offers alot of pictures of different places so that mighit help.

St. Lucia is a beautiful island - very green and mountainous and jsut so lush and tropical. It does not have the white sand since it is a volcano island but so much to see and do.

St. Lucia will be alot mroe money, however then Jaaica, which is really one of the more affordable islands to go too. Cancun too is pretty good in price but we personally do n ot like the Cancun strip - too many highrises, no charm. Need to go outside the area like to Riveris Maya/Sun Coast.
